Frequently Asked Questions - SCN-P360L3.03 MDT

How do I adjust the detection range?
Turn the sensitivity potentiometer located on the unit. Clockwise increases range, counterclockwise decreases. Test with a walk test.
What is the maximum mounting height?
The recommended mounting height is 2.5 to 4 meters for optimal 360° coverage.
Can the SCN-P360L3.03 be used outdoors?
No, it has an IP20 rating, meaning it is only suitable for indoor use. Exposure to moisture may damage the device.
How do I reset the detector to factory settings?
There is no factory reset. To restore default settings, turn the sensitivity and time delay potentiometers fully counterclockwise, then adjust as needed.
How do I connect the wires?
Connect the phase (L), neutral (N), and load (L') wires according to the wiring diagram in the manual. Ensure power is off before installation.
What does the LED indicator mean?
A solid LED indicates detection. A flashing LED during warm-up (approx. 30 seconds) means the detector is initializing.
How do I set the light sensor threshold?
Use the LUX potentiometer. Turn it to the sun symbol for daylight operation or to the moon symbol for night-only operation.
Why does the detector trigger falsely?
False triggers can be caused by heat sources (e.g., heaters), pets, or reflections. Adjust sensitivity and mounting position to reduce false alarms.
How do I change the time delay?
Turn the TIME potentiometer clockwise for longer delay (up to 30 min) or counterclockwise for shorter delay (minimum 10 seconds).
Is there a manual override for continuous light?
Yes, you can override the detector by switching the connected light switch off and on within 2 seconds. The light will stay on for 4 hours or until manually turned off.
